The Indian rupee strengthened 15 paise against the dollar in early trade today as the US currency weakened against other major currencies.

At the Interbank Foreign Exchange (Forex) market, the local unit, which had gained 33 paise to 47.47/48 a dollar yesterday, appreciated by 15 paise to 47.32 in early trade.
Forex dealers attributed the rise in the Indian currency to the greenback losing strength against other major currencies.
